On the occasion of Mother’s Day, several Bollywood celebrities took to their social media platforms to express heartfelt emotions and gratitude towards their mothers. The internet was flooded with touching posts, old memories, and warm messages, celebrating the strength, love, and sacrifice of mothers.
Kareena Kapoor Khan shared a powerful post on Instagram Stories, highlighting the strength of motherhood. The quote read: “Don’t underestimate a mother. She’s survived pain that would make others crumble. She’s endured sleep deprivation that breaks the mind. She’s held her baby while holding herself together. No applause. No break. Just relentless love. That’s strength.” She added heart and rainbow emojis, showing her appreciation for mothers everywhere.

Filmmaker Karan Johar also shared a sweet tribute to his mother Hiroo Johar. Posting a loving picture with her, he simply captioned it, “love love love love love love YOU!!!!!!!”, expressing deep affection with a repetition of words that spoke volumes.

Veteran actor Anil Kapoor took a nostalgic route and shared a collage of four pictures featuring memorable moments with his mother. He wished her a Happy Mother’s Day..

Actor Allu Arjun also shared warm pictures with his mother, celebrating her on this special day.

Meanwhile, producer Boney Kapoor posted an emotional throwback photo from his childhood, posing with his mother. He wrote, “Maa You were my favorite hello and my hardest goodbye,” touching many hearts online.

Other stars like Malaika Arora, Rohit Saraf, Soha Ali Khan, and Bipasha Basu also joined in, sharing heartfelt notes and unseen photos with their mothers, showering them with love and admiration.

Mother’s Day 2025 turned into a digital celebration of love and gratitude as celebrities honoured the guiding women in their lives, reminding fans of the timeless bond between a mother and child.
